Jeep Renegade - Video tutorial
Model: Jeep Renegade
BU, 520, MK 1
- Years 2014-2023 Today's steps will show us how to deactivate the front passenger airbag of the Jeep Renegade, following the instructions below. First, let's get inside the vehicle and start the dashboard; then, let's go to the settings menu of the onboard computer using the steering wheel controls, and click on the airbag option and then on the passenger option, as shown in the video. At this point, let's deactivate the airbag, making sure that the warning light illuminates; apply the opposite procedure to reactivate the passenger airbag!
